Job Description
Overview ($17.36-$20.83) This classification may include various general laborer functions such as plug, assembly, finishing, punch press, grinding, running robots and running various machinery. Responsibilities may include loading, moving materials, assisting in loading machines, positioning work, setting up jobs, making adjustments or operating machines, final assembly operations plugging, visual inspections. Performs hand operations, such as filing, de-burring, cleaning, disc grinding, palletizing, banding, folding, etc. Uses torque wrench and hand tools as needed. Responsibilities Lifts, positions, and removes work pieces from machines to assist in assembly, forming, fitting, and welding Loads, stacks, and transports stock, tools, dies, and work in process by hand, pallet jack, or dolly Cleans, scrapes, and grinds metal to fabricating, welding, painting, or shipping Sets up machine and/or helps set up machines for operation and may make minor adjustments as needed; Run machines after set-up Checks and monitors the condition of dies, punches, and quality of product being produced Accurately measures and reads blueprints to check parts for compliance Picks up and moves scrap from work areas, cleans work area, machines, tools, and equipment Performs final assembly operations Ensures adequate supply of stock is at station to run machines; operates hoists and slings; fills out production reports and label product as needed Qualifications High school diploma or general education degree (GED). Must be able to handle up to 50lbs. Good Communication skills Attention to detail
